On January 29, 2015, the Comisión Federal de Electricidad ("CFE"), the Mexican public utilities company, announced a tender process for new electric energy projects and natural gas transportation infrastructure. The projects are expected bring additional investments of US$3.276 billion into the Mexican energy sector and, upon completion, will add 1,015 kilometers to Mexico's natural gas pipeline system, 666 megawatts ("MW") to Mexico's installed power generation capacity, and 989 kilometers to Mexico's power transmission lines. Bid guidelines are expected to be issued between February and April 2015.

The projects include: (i) three natural gas pipelines in different regions of the country; (ii) one project to transport natural gas to the State of Baja California; (iii) one combined cycle power plant in the State of Sinaloa; (iv) four power transmission line and substation projects in different regions of the country; and (v) three power distribution projects in different regions of the country.

Here are additional details and timelines for the projects published by the CFE:

Natural Gas Transportation Projects

Samalayuca—Sasabe Pipeline

  • Location and Investment: Chihuahua and Sonora, US$916 million
  • CFE Reserved Capacity: 550 million cubic feet per day ("MMCFD")
  • Approximate Length: 528 kilometers
  • Bid Guidelines Issued: March 2015
  • Proposals Due: May 2015
  • Award of Contract: June 2015
  • Commercial Operation Date: June 2017

Colombia—Escobedo Pipeline

  • Location and Investment: Nuevo León, US$450 million
  • CFE Reserved Capacity: 500 MMCFD
  • Approximate Length: 250 kilometers
  • Bid Guidelines Issued: March 2015
  • Proposals Due: May 2015
  • Award of Contract: June 2015
  • Commercial Operation Date: June 2017

Tuxpan—Tula Pipeline

  • Location and Investment: Veracruz, Puebla, Hidalgo, US$350 million
  • CFE Reserved Capacity: 700 MMCFD
  • Approximate Length: 237 kilometers
  • Bid Guidelines Issued: February 2015
  • Proposals Due: May 2015
  • Award of Contract: June 2015
  • Commercial Operation Date: March 2017

Natural Gas Supply to Baja California

  • Location and Investment: Sinaloa, Baja California Sur, US$600 million
  • CFE Reserved Capacity: 170 MMCFD
  • Approximate Length: Open Technology Bidding (marine transport)
  • Bid Guidelines Issued: March 2015
  • Proposals Due: May 2015
  • Award of Contract: June 2015
  • Commercial Operation Date: June 2017

Electric Power Generation Projects

Topolobampo III Combined Cycle Power Plant

  • Location and Investment: Sinaloa, US$631 million
  • CFE Reserved Capacity: 666 MW
  • Bid Guidelines Issued: November 18, 2014
  • Proposals Due: June 2015
  • Award of Contract: August 2015
  • Commercial Operation Date: June 2018

Power Transmission Projects

706 North Systems (3rd Phase)

  • Location and Investment: Baja California Norte, US$17 million
  • Line Capacity: 115 kilovolts ("kV')
  • Approximate Length: 8.60 kilometers in circuit
  • Bid Guidelines Issued: January 20, 2015
  • Proposals Due: March 2015
  • Award of Contract: April 2015
  • Commercial Operation Date: September 2016

1905 Southeast Transmission—Peninsular

  • Location and Investment: Quintana Roo, Campeche, US$64 million
  • Line Capacity: 230 kV
  • Approximate Length: 367 kilometers in circuit
  • Bid Guidelines Issued: March 2015
  • Proposals Due: May 2015
  • Award of Contract: June 2015
  • Commercial Operation Date: January 2017

1811 Transmission Line to Empalme I Power Plant

  • Location and Investment: Sonora, US$105 million
  • Line Capacity: 400 and 230 kV
  • Approximate Length: 421.10 kilometers in circuit
  • Bid Guidelines Issued: March 2015
  • Proposals Due: June 2015
  • Award of Contract: July 2015
  • Commercial Operation Date: January 2017

1911 Transmission Line to Empalme II Power Plant

  • Location and Investment: Sonora, Sinaloa, US$116 million
  • Line Capacity: 400 kV
  • Approximate Length: 118 kilometers in circuit
  • Bid Guidelines Issued: April 2015
  • Proposals Due: July 2015
  • Award of Contract: July 2015
  • Commercial Operation Date: February 2017

Power Distribution Projects

1420 North Distribution (2nd Phase)

  • Location and Investment: Sonora, US$7 million
  • Substation Capacity: 115 to 13.8 kV with 8 feeders
  • Approximate Length: 3.10 kilometers in circuit
  • Bid Guidelines Issued: January 20, 2015
  • Proposals Due: April 2015
  • Award of Contract: May 2015
  • Commercial Operation Date: May 2016

1721 North Distribution (3rd Phase)

  • Location and Investment: Chihuahua, US$12 million
  • Substation Capacity: 115 kV with 1 feeder
  • Approximate Length: 64.30 kilometers in circuit
  • Bid Guidelines Issued: January 30, 2015
  • Proposals Due: April 2015
  • Award of Contract: May 2015
  • Commercial Operation Date: June 2016

1621 North–South Distribution (6th Phase)

  • Location and Investment: Yucatán, US$8 million
  • Substation Capacity: 115 kV with 8 feeders
  • Approximate Length: 3.10 kilometers in circuit
  • Bid Guidelines Issued: March 2015
  • Proposals Due: June 2015
  • Award of Contract: July 2015
  • Commercial Operation Date: July 2016

CFE will continue to announce tenders for projects to modernize different aspects of Mexico's power and natural gas infrastructure and to meet industrial and domestic demand for power and for cheaper sources of fuel.
